"The Belvedine" is an unreleased song by Ween. It is a White Pepper outtake.

Song Details[edit | edit source]

"The Belvedine" was recorded in 1998 and included on The Long Beach Island Tape,[1] a tape of White Pepper demos stolen from the band in 2000.[2] As such, the ethics of circulating this song is disputed.
